Ebay to buy Depop from Etsy in £890m cash deal in latest bid to woo younger customers


Ebay has agreed to buy secondhand fashion marketplace Depop from Etsy for around $1.2billion, or £890million, in cash. Online platform Etsy is offloading Depop just five years after it bought the British business for $1.6billion. The cash deal is expected to be completed by the middle of 2026 and will see Depop retain its name and branding. Ianonne said: 'We are confident that as part of eBay, Depop will be even more well-positioned for long-term growth, benefiting from our scale, complementary offerings, and operational capabilities'. It comes just months after Ebay bought another rival secondhand app, in a bid to appeal to younger shoppers.
